Sigma Planning Corp lifted its position in iShares MSCI USA Min Vol Factor ETF (BATS:USMV – Free Report) by 4.0%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 156,526 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 6,073 shares during the quarter. Sigma Planning Corp’s holdings in iShares MSCI USA Min Vol Factor ETF were worth $14,516,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

iShares MSCI USA Min Vol Factor ETF Profile
The iShares MSCI USA Min Vol Factor ETF (USMV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I USA Minimum Volatility (USD) index. The fund tracks an index of US-listed firms selected and weighted to create a low-volatility portfolio subject to various constraints. USMV was launched on Oct 18, 2011 and is managed by BlackRock.
